| Comments: |
Beautiful, mild, sunny day with no wind. All the trails are a packed sidewalk. Elected to go up the Avalon luge track instead of coming down it. Brought my snowshoes along, but not needed today. I used my (Modified) Hillsounds car to car and they worked great. If your spikes aren't sharp or long enough, Crampons on the Avalon luge wouldn't be an overkill. |
